Output e0c7910b5665a1605c5e758ed1bd5ff98b95e46d90924b0a1a6e869f57a3a4cb:3

value
17800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c391096f3e7e01b40ea40e5e5bcfdc4e3565e2 OP_EQUAL
address
37bTT2HiPYuJJBTwGVSryB642YHw1CVKEq
transaction
e0c7910b5665a1605c5e758ed1bd5ff98b95e46d90924b0a1a6e869f57a3a4cb
spent
true